The Castle Café

Located inside the historic Blackrock Castle, The Castle Café is one of the most unique breakfast places in Cork. The menu at this Mediterranean-inspired café combines history with food. Just imagine yourself sitting within stone walls dating back hundreds of years. You are enjoying ricotta pancakes with burnt pineapple or potato and kale boxty. The café prides itself on locally sourced products and seasonal produce, so freshness is assured. Dining here feels as if you are stepping back in time while savouring modern-day favourites. This is a wonderful place to enjoy your breakfast infused with a bit of history. You won’t find a better place for a nice breakfast with a touch of history.

Elizabeth Fort cafe 

History lovers will find Elizabeth Fort Cafe to be another excellent venue. The café, within Elizabeth Fort, has nice views of Cork city while serving an interesting breakfast menu. You can order a cup of coffee with some poached eggs; the perfect combo. The ambience here is also fabulous. The historical backdrop only enhances the experience of eating breakfast. It is a great place for those who are sightseeing in Cork city while also enjoying the history.

Café Spresso

It is located right in the middle of the Cork city centre. Café Spresso is an ideal place for a good hearty breakfast without spending too much. The mushrooms and eggs on toast are staples that are simple, yet enjoyable. The café also provides an international menu. You can have a Hungarian breakfast or a Polish breakfast if you have a different taste. The café has outdoor seating. So you can sit in the morning sun enjoying your breakfast. If you’re looking for a filling breakfast or a full Irish breakfast, just go there. You won’t be let down.

The Farmgate Cafe

The Farmgate Cafe is located within the famous English Market. It is dedicated to quality food sourced locally. The top selection is their Market English Breakfast. It includes a beautiful combination of sausages, eggs, mushrooms, tomatoes, and toast, all on one plate. Vegetarians also have plenty of options to choose from. The setting is convenient for those wanting the best breakfast in Cork city. Also for those who want to support fresh, local sources.
